Position Overview

The Mortgage Underwriter is responsible for rendering credit decisions on mortgage and home equity loans in accordance with credit union policies and procedures and with secondary market guidelines. The Mortgage Underwriter also interacts with vendors, attorneys, members and realtors to ensure a quick and efficient approval and closing process.

Essential Functions
•    Underwrite mortgages and home equity loans in accordance with applicable policies and procedures; issue commitments for such loans and clear loans for closing.

•    Cross sell credit union products, including non-real estate products. Participation in employee incentive program is required. Must meet or exceed sales goals established by management.

•    Monitor the status of mortgages and home equities in process. Follow-up with members, member's attorneys, appraisers, etc. in an effort to expedite the processing of applications.

•    Evaluate loan applications to determine eligibility, acceptability, and compliance with federal and state regulations, secondary market guideline and credit union requirements.

•    Examine property appraisals for compliance with federal and state regulations, secondary market guidelines and credit union requirements.

•    Coordinate with credit union real estate attorneys, PMI companies, investors and other vendors, when necessary, to facilitate mortgage approvals and closing.

•    Approve modification requests, subordination agreements, PMI removal requests and release of liability agreements when requested by members.

•    Prepare home equity commitments and home equity loans for closing.

Licensure Requirements
•    In compliance with the Secure and Fair Enforcement for Mortgage Licensing Act of 2008 (S.A.F.E. Act) and the statute’s regulations, applicants must be eligible to register as a Mortgage Loan Originator (MLO). Candidates being considered will be subject to a credit check and fingerprinting.
